There's no question that Triumph Specialty is the top of the sleaze
heap.

But Bob Yarwood and his company, British Parts Direct, are right up
there.  In fact I'd even say BPD is more insidious, becuase you
can't *see* the problem when you get the part.  The cases I rememebr
off the top of my head are a poorly ground cam, a pre-cracked crank,
poorly machined roller rockers, and a leaky block.  Just looking at
ahy one of these parts would show nothing wrong.  The rockers and
block actually got installed in cars before the problems were
realized.  I believe Miq Millman was the one to peg the bad cam
before he put it in the car, and upon recommendations from the
brit-cars list, whoever bought the crank had the sense to get it
magnafluxed before putting it in an engine.  I still have my rocker
shaft with the rockers wedged on it.
